    Cargus signs the diversity charter

    Cargus signed the Diversity Charter, thus taking on the commitment to promote and implement practices in the spirit of values such as diversity, equality and inclusion.

    The signing of the initiative represents a normal step for the most experienced courier company on the Romanian market, celebrating 30 years of activity this year.

    Under the anniversary motto “We have come to know each other”, the company welcomes the loyalty of its employees, customers and partners and also states that it will continue to adapt its business to the expectations of the community. On the road to a fair, inclusive and equitable world, diversity and social inclusion represent an important pillar for Cargus in the new strategy of sustainability and social responsibility.

    “We have signed the Diversity Charter with the conviction that different experiences and perspectives lead to great things. We believe in equal opportunities and aim to increase these values ​​and practices in our organizational culture. Adherence to the principles of the Charter is a first step in our plan to form skills with a positive impact on Romanian society.

    In our 30 years of work, we have learned that all our employees must feel supported and respected and that we must offer everyone opportunities to reach their professional potential, regardless of nationality, age, gender, ethnicity, sexual orientation or religion. We encourage other companies to join this initiative, as these values ​​are the foundation through which we can build a diverse and inclusive community together,” said Jarosław Śliwa, CEO of Cargus.

    Along with social inclusion, Cargus complements its responsibility strategy through three other areas of interest: environment, health and education.
